About Chico Marx
Full bar with craft cocktail menu, wine, and beer. Mix of communal tables and intimate seating. Smart and stylish space suitable for special occasions. Flexible event spaces for intimate or large affairs. Two AV-equipped private dining rooms. Subtle... More

We come here pretty often for company lunches and the food never disappoints! The appetizers are all great and they rotate the menu options pretty frequently so there’s always new stuff to try. My personal go-to is the lomo saltado- make sure to ask for their home made salsa for that extra heat! Service is always wonderful and the servers are super friendly.
I fell in love with this restaurant on a recent work trip and ended up eating there 3x! The menu is so interesting that I wanted to try everything. And everything was delicious. I brought colleagues with me each time and we recommend everything we had: breakfast burrito; calamari, olives, croquettes on the happy hour menu; little gem and arugula salads; vegetarian wrap; soup; and (perfect) guacamole. Shout out to Tessa for noticing that I was a repeat customer and being so welcoming, and to Chef for coming to say hello! Prices are very reasonable, especially for San Francisco, and the vibe is cool, down to earth, comfortable. This place gets it all right.
